Common Questions People Have About 100 Questions to Ask Your Girlfriend: Deepen Your Connection

H3: How do I start asking these questions without making conversation awkward?
Begin casually—timing matters. Use natural openings like a quiet evening at home or while doing routine activities. Pair questions with warmth—“I was thinking…” or “What do you think about…”—to signal sincerity and openness.

H3: Do these questions always lead to deep talks?
Not every exchange will be intense—but consistency matters more than intensity. Regular, low-pressure questions build comfort and routine, making deeper topics easier over time. The goal is gradual, organic connection, not forced intensity.

H3: How do I respond when my partner is quiet or uncomfortable?
Respect boundaries. If a question triggers hesitation, acknowledge it gently. Compassionate follow-ups like “If you’d rather not talk about that, that’s okay” maintain trust and psychological safety.

H3: Can these questions help couples with busy schedules?
Absolutely. Short, focused sets of 3–5 questions take minutes to explore. Scheduling brief check-ins during commutes, walks, or meals supports consistent connection without overwhelming packed routines.
